Memorae is the most interesting neighbor on this list because it made the same core bet: WhatsApp is where assistance should live. As an AI memory assistant it goes broader than reminders, remembering facts, tracking commitments, helping you recall what you told it weeks ago, and for people who want a conversational second brain inside WhatsApp, that ambition is real and the product attacks a bigger problem than nagging.
Breadth is also the risk. A memory assistant succeeds on how well it recalls; a reminder tool succeeds on whether the message arrives at exactly the right minute, every time, boringly. NagMeLater is narrow on purpose: parsing, scheduling, recurrence, snooze, streaks, all tuned for the single job of firing on time on WhatsApp. Premium AI assistants also price like AI products, Memorae's paid tier starts around $9.99/month, five times NagMeLater's price, with the reminder job as one feature among many rather than the whole point.

Both work on WhatsApp. Memorae is an AI memory agent, it remembers information you share, tracks commitments from your conversations, and provides smart summaries. NagMeLater focuses specifically on exact-time reminder delivery: you ask for a reminder at a specific time, it fires at exactly that time. NagMeLater is a specialist; Memorae is a generalist.
For exact-time, recurring, and group reminders, NagMeLater is more focused and tested. Memorae's broader AI scope means reminder accuracy may vary. If your primary need is "remind me tomorrow at 9am and every week after", NagMeLater is the more reliable choice.
Use Memorae when you want an AI assistant that can recall information from past conversations ("what did I say about the Smith proposal?"), track commitments across discussions, or provide smart summaries of your work. NagMeLater doesn't have memory capabilities, it focuses only on timed delivery.
Yes. You could use Memorae for AI memory and context recall, and NagMeLater for reliable exact-time WhatsApp reminders. They serve different enough purposes that they can complement each other.
Memorae has a free tier; the full AI features require a premium plan at $9.99+/month. NagMeLater gives a free 7-day unlimited trial then costs $1.99/month. For pure reminder use, NagMeLater is cheaper.
